Spoiler: Treason chargesThat is a good point, although Peggy probably saved countless people by stealing back Cap's blood. Attempts to recreate Erskine's formula usually end in disaster. I mean even in the MCU we have Blonsky turning into the abomination (Cap serum and gamma radation do NOT mix well.) In Iron Man 3 an attempt to create super-soldiers led to the whole extremis mess and the Centipede guys from agents of shield had a mixture of Cap serum, extremis, and gamma radiation. So I would assume if the blood ends up in the wrong hands we'll just end up with another cackling supervillian.

Spoiler: Ring a ding dingI don't think the ring was magical, but I do think it was key to his technique.
TV hypnosis, what's used? Soft, steady voice, accompanied by a rhythmic visual or tactile distraction for the mind to focus on while the voice reaches the subconscious.
The ring twisting was at even intervals and glinting, the equivalent of a swinging watch, or rotating "hypno-disk."
